NEW DELHI: The war of words between Team Anna and the government grew intense on Sunday, with Kiran Bedi describing Prime Minister Manmohan Singh as Dhritarashtra. Bedi invoked the character of the blind king in the Mahabharata to attack Singh to allege that his 'tainted team' will not give a strong criminal justice system. The comment invited a sharp rebuff from law minister Salman Khurshid, who said a personal campaign will not work and that Team Anna was not being helpful for democracy and the country.

BJP supported Team Anna's demand for a probe into allegations of corruption against the UPA. However, BJP pulled its punches saying that it is natural that the 'taint' would reach Singh as he is the leader, though honest.

This latest round was flared off with a Bedi tweet: "PMO clears prime minister. Did Dhritarashtra in Mahabharata not support Kauravas even after they attempted to disrobe Draupadi? Indian genes/culture? Or?" Bedi's tweet comes a day after the Prime Minister's Office rejected Anna Hazare's demands for setting up a special investigation team to probe graft allegations against Singh and 14 Cabinet colleagues, and the demand to set up a fast-track court to take up corruption cases against MPs.

V Narayanasamy, MoS in the PMO, had on Saturday alleged Hazare was surrounded by 'anti-national' elements and supported by 'foreign' forces. "Do or Die fast from July 25 for SIT probe on PM+14 Cab Ministers. Tainted team may never give us an expeditious and strong criminal justice system," Bedi alleged, a day after she termed the PMO letter as "absolutely wishy-washy".

Reacting to Bedi's tweets, Khurshid said: "We all felt they started off with a good idea. Idea of containing corruption and questioning corruption was a good idea. But today, they are doing greatest disservice to this idea by converting it into a personal campaign and personal ambition. I will quite confidently say that the country will give them a suitable answer when the time comes," the law minister said.

Union minister Vayalar Ravi too questioned the credibility of Team Anna. "I suspect that Anna Hazare and his people are not that innocent and every one of them go to the Magsaysay award, which has been funded by the American foundations," Ravi told reporters in Hyderabad.
